# Hermann Hesse

German-Swiss author and poet whose novels "Siddhartha," "Steppenwolf," "Narcissus and Goldmund," and "The Glass Bead Game" explore the tension between spirituality and sensuality, and between the East and West. His works experienced a massive revival during the 1960s counter-culture movement and remain among the most widely read German-language novels. Nobel Prize in Literature 1946.
